What is Whole Family Wellness?
Whole Family Wellness (WFW) is a holistic approach to understanding and achieving health and wellbeing for the entire family. The World Health Org (WHO) defines health as a “State of complete physical, mental, & social well-being, & not merely the absence of disease or infirmity.“ The National Wellness Institute defines health as "a conscious, self-directed, & evolving process of achieving full potential."
Wellness for the entire family means each member is experiencing wellbeing and the family unit is healthy as a whole.

The Public Education Campaign promotes educates, advocates, and guides communities on a holistic approach to wellness. We work with communities, businesses, and schools to implement measures to strengthen and maintain communities' understanding and development of holistic wellness. This approach encompasses all facets of life, including:
Emotional/mental Environmental
Financial Intellectual
Occupational Physical
Social Spiritual
The goal of these sessions is to provide an avenue to understanding and giving voice to the concerns and lived experiences of parents.
A parent listening session will either be in person at one of our sites or via Zoom consisting of two students and 7-8 parents. In the session, students will interview parents using our parent needs survey questions to get information on what resources parents are looking for.
